The species of this genus are often restricted to the upper moist sand substratum (medium water level, <i>D. subterraneus, D. ankeli</i>, and <i>D. benazzii</i>), or to the lower midlittoral and upper sublittoral (<i>D. minimus</i>, and <i>D. dohrni</i>). In natural environments a single species occurs at each horizontal level. The distribution pattern between upper and lower levels may be controlled by physical factors. Interspecific competition between congeneric species of <i>Diurodrilus</i> may be considered as a possible cause controlling populations within each horizontal sandy beach level. It is possible to identify morphological differences between species inhabiting each horizontal level of a sandy beach. In the lower level, always scoured by the waves, <i>Diurodrilus minimus</i> and <i>D. dohrni</i> have well developed toes, reacting with adhesion to increased water currents, while in the more stable upper level, <i>D. benazzii</i> and <i>D. subterraneus</i> display reduced adhesive toes, both in size and number. <i>Diurodrilus benazzii</i> was collected from the midlittoral phreatic system in a sandy beach at the Gulf of Valencia (W. Mediterranean). Since no information is available on taxonomical characters of <i>D. benazzii</i>, e.g., the sensorial pattern, ciliophores, or ventral ciliation, this paper provides a redescription of the species, comparing the taxonomically relevant characters of all known <i>Diurodrilus</i> species.).
